Toolkit Harm Reduction in Rural Areas: A Workbook for Homeless Response System Staff
Published: January 6, 2025
The Harm Reduction in Rural Communities workbook is designed to help rural areas implement harm reduction strategies, including Housing First principles. It addresses the unique challenges communities may face if they have not yet adopted harm reduction methods or have struggled to acquire the capacity and knowledge to do so. This workbook focuses on the practical implementation of these principles to encourage readers to think about how they can best adopt harm reduction and Housing First strategies in their communities. The following pages contain facts, implementation strategies, reflection questions, and links to more information.
Topics include:
- Principles of Harm Reduction in Rural Communities
- Myths and Facts about Harm Reduction
- Principles of Housing First in Rural Communities
- Harm Reduction Strategies and Implementation
- Advocating for Harm Reduction in Rural Communities
